Aston, Ariège
Aston () is a Communes of France, commune in the Ariège (department), Ariège Departments of France, department in the Occitania (administrative region), Occitanie region of south-western France. Geography Aston is located some 90 km west of Perpignan and 30 km south of Foix. It is located high in the Pyrenees with its southern border the border between France and Andorra. Access to the commune is solely by a local road from Les Cabannes, Ariège, Les Cabannes in the north to the village which lies at the northern tip of the commune. The D522 road from Les Cabannes passes down the eastern border of the commune in a tortuous route which terminates at the Angaka ski resort just east of the commune. Except for a very small area around the village the commune is extremely rugged and heavily forested. Électricité De France
Électricité de France SA (; ), commonly known as EDF, is a French multinational corporation, multinational electric utility company owned by the government of France. Headquartered in Paris, with €139.7 billion in sales in 2023, EDF operates a diverse portfolio of at least 120 gigawatts of generation capacity in Europe, South America, North America, Asia, the Middle East, and Africa. In 2009, EDF was the world's largest producer of electricity. Its 56 active nuclear reactors in France are spread out over 18 sites (18 nuclear power plants). They comprise 32 reactors of 900 MWe, MWe, 20 reactors of 1,300 MWe, MWe, and 4 reactors of 1,450 MWe, all Pressurized water reactor, PWRs. EDF was created on 8 April 1946 by the 1945 parliament, from the merging of various divided actors. Hydroelectricity
Hydroelectricity, or hydroelectric power, is Electricity generation, electricity generated from hydropower (water power). Hydropower supplies 15% of the world's electricity, almost 4,210 TWh in 2023, which is more than all other Renewable energy, renewable sources combined and also more than nuclear power. Hydropower can provide large amounts of Low-carbon power, low-carbon electricity on demand, making it a key element for creating secure and clean electricity supply systems. A hydroelectric power station that has a dam and reservoir is a flexible source, since the amount of electricity produced can be increased or decreased in seconds or minutes in response to varying electricity demand. Once a hydroelectric complex is constructed, it produces no direct waste, and almost always emits considerably less greenhouse gas than fossil fuel-powered energy plants.

Soldeu
Soldeu () is a village and ski resort in Andorra in the Pyrenees mountains, located in the parish of Canillo. Overview It comes alive in the winter months as a ski town, and is part of the Grand Valira ski resort, the largest in the Pyrenees with of ski runs.GrandvaliraSoldeu, Grandvalira ''grandvalira.com'', 2011. According to ''The Sunday Times'', Soldeu is one of the three best budget skiing resorts in Europe.S Newsom (2009)Three of the best budget resorts—Europe's top ski resorts are hideously expensive—but we have a solution ''The Sunday Times'', 4 October 2009. (Last accessed 2009-10-08) The ski area links to Encamp, Canillo, El Tarter, Grau Roig and Pas de la Casa. The Soldeu Ski School has a large number of native English speaking instructors and has won awards for the quality of its tuition. L'Hospitalet-près-l'Andorre
L'Hospitalet-près-l'Andorre (, literally ''L'Hospitalet near the Andorra''; ) is a commune in the Ariège department of southwestern France. The area has a history of vulnerability to winter avalanches: one such in 1895 killed 12 (nearly 10% of the commune's population at the time), and much destruction was also caused in 1906 and 1929.Risques avalanches . Notice sur les avalanches constatées et leur environnement, tp://avalanchesftp.grenoble.cemagref.fr/epaclpa/notices_par_massif/orlusaintbartelemy.pdf Avalanches have from time to time blocked the N20, the main road through the commune, the most recent case being in 2008.L'Hospitalet. Ax-les-Thermes
Ax-les-Thermes (; or ) is a Communes of France, commune in the Ariège (department), Ariège Departments of France, department in the Occitania (administrative region), Occitanie Regions of France, region of southwestern France. The commune has been awarded one flower by the ''National Council of Towns and Villages in Bloom'' in the ''Competition of cities and villages in Bloom''. Geography Ax-les-Thermes is situated in the Pyrénées, close to Andorra, and stands on the confluence of the Oriège, Ariège (river), Ariège and Lauze rivers. some 75 km west of Perpignan and 35 km north-east of Andorra la Vella. Access to the commune is by Route nationale N20 from Garanou in the northwest which passes through the village then south through the commune to Mérens-les-Vals. The D613 goes north from the village to Sorgeat and the D25 branches from this to go east to Ascou and Mijanès.
